2025-11-09 11:44:46
比特币(Bitcoin)自2009年问世以来,作为首个成功的去中心化数字货币,已改变了人们对金融的传统认知。为了安全、便捷地管理比特币,钱包的使用显得尤为重要。比特币钱包API的开发与利用,进一步提升了用户体验和应用场景。接下来将详细解析比特币钱包API的概念、功能、优势、应用场景以及注意事项。
比特币钱包API(Application Programming Interface)是开发者与比特币钱包之间的通讯协议。它允许开发者通过编程方式与钱包进行交互,执行一系列操作,例如创建新地址、查询余额、发送和接收比特币等。比特币钱包的API通常提供RESTful接口,使得与web服务的集成变得更加简便。
在使用比特币钱包API时,开发者通常需要进行身份验证,以确保安全。这种身份验证通常包括API密钥和其他安全措施,以保证用户数据的安全和隐私。
比特币钱包API通常具备以下几个主要功能:
使用比特币钱包API可以带来许多优势:
比特币钱包API的应用场景非常广泛,主要包括以下几个方面:
虽然比特币钱包API提供了便利性,但安全问题依然不容忽视。开发者在使用API时需要注意以下几点:
选择合适的比特币钱包API需要考虑多个因素。首先,开发者应该评估API的功能是否满足其需求。例如,是否支持多币种?是否能满足高并发请求?其次,必须关注API的安全性,确保其有良好的身份验证和数据加密机制。此外,还应查看API的文档是否详细,以便更容易地进行开发和集成。此外,考虑到沟通的灵活性以及社区的支持情况,选择一个活跃的API平台也非常重要。
最后,不同API的费用结构也需要关注,选择适合自己预算的API是至关重要的。例如某些API提供免费额度,适合初创企业或开发者进行测试,但需要确保在超出免费限额时,不会造成意外的费用增加。
开发使用比特币钱包API的流程一般包括以下几个步骤:
在使用比特币钱包API的过程中,开发者可能会遇到一些常见错误,以下是几个例子及相应的解决方案。
首先,身份验证失败是常见问题之一。可能的原因包括API密钥错误或未发送密钥。解决方法是仔细核对API密钥,并确保在请求中包含它。
其次,请求超时也时有发生,可能由服务器负载过高或网络问题导致。建议重试请求,或检查网络连接状况,以确保正常访问API。
还有交易失败的问题,通常是由于余额不足或地址格式错误。开发者可以通过调用余额查询接口,确认余额是否足够,并验证输入地址格式。
最后,API调用频率受到限制的问题常出现在高并发请求情况下。开发者应该查阅API文档,了解其调用频率限制,并合理安排请求频次。
随着区块链技术和加密货币的快速发展,比特币钱包API也在不断演进,展现出以下发展趋势:
首先,增强安全性是比特币钱包API未来发展的重点,随着网络攻击的增多,API服务商将会加大对身份验证及数据加密等技术的投入,以更好地保护用户资产。
其次,多币种支持将成为比特币钱包API更为重要的方向。随着以太坊、莱特币等多种加密货币的普及,支持多种数字货币的API将越来越受到欢迎。
第三,集成更多金融服务是未来的发展趋势。这可能包括贷款、保险、投资等多种金融服务,通过API实现无缝对接,给用户带来更为丰富的体验。
最后,去中心化的趋势也不容忽视。随着去中心化金融(DeFi)的崛起,未来的比特币钱包API可能越发向去中心化的方向发展,减少传统金融机构的参与,为用户提供更加自主的服务。
在国际市场上,比特币钱包API的竞争非常激烈。主要的竞争来自于一些知名的区块链平台和金融科技公司。例如,Coinbase、Binance等大平台提供的API服务因其强大的用户基础和技术支持,受到了开发者的广泛青睐。
此外,还有一些新兴的小型API服务商通过提供更灵活的服务和优惠的价格,逐渐在市场上占有一席之地。这些服务商通常致力于提升用户体验,以满足小型企业及个人开发者的需求。
对于个人开发者,在选择API服务时,需要关注个别API的功能、费用、安全性以及社区支持等多个方面。同时,保持对市场变化的敏锐嗅觉,不断根据竞争动态来调整开发策略,也显得格外重要。
总之,比特币钱包API的市场发展潜力巨大,随着技术的不断革新,它将在未来的金融科技领域发挥越来越重要的作用。